All ARCA Italian courses include two activities a week which present an introduction to Italian social and cultural life. They are generally free of charge, and only on occasion is it necessary to pay a small supplement, which is in any case deducted.

The programme of activities changes every six months. The following is a sample of our activities for the spring-summer semester and the autumn-winter semester.

  • Guided tours of the city, museums and exhibitions.
  • Practical cookery courses with a final dinner at the “La cucina di Petronilla” school.
  • Wine tasting at a typical Bolognese wine merchant's
  • Half day excursions to local companies of interest (Ducati, Parmigiano Reggiano, Aceto Balsamico Tradizionale, Esse Caffè and also others of interest)
  • Visits to farms and farm holiday businesses near Bologna to discover and get to know Emilia Romagna's rich gastronomic culture and traditions
  • Half-day visits to the cities of art around Bologna (Modena, Ferrara, Parma, Ravenna, Mantova) and to small medieval villages in the region to experience local feast-days and medieval and renaissance festivals.
  • Taking part in Bologna's many cultural and intercultural events: art, cinema, shows.
